Matthew 25:34-40, ESV … WebThe Homeless Church was born when Evan Prosser was pastor of a church in Orland, California. God stopped him as he was driving home, and told him to resign the church in Orland and go to San Francisco to start a church of homeless people. WebThe Emergency Services Program is located in space provided by the Church of the Good Shepherd at 345 S. 312th in Federal Way (Please do not call the Church or go to the Church's office). FWCCN is open from 10:00 a.m. - 12:00 noon on Tuesday mornings in the lower hall of the church.
